Ticket #20318 — Night-shift access, Support team corridor

Visiting contractors working past 20:00 must use the east entrance of the Quillhaven Annex; the main doors lock automatically. The support team's corridor remains accessible overnight for ticketed work only. Sign in at the wall terminal on arrival and again when leaving. Escort requirements are waived for this engagement.

Enter the corridor using the badge code below.

door code, tagef-bajop: bdg-SB-7

Finance Review Summary — Project Lanternside

Quick one for the sales leads: Lanternside, our internal quoting-tool rebuild, has slipped another quarter. Vendor delays plus a scope change from the Ostrey team pushed go-live to spring. Budget impact is modest, but keep using the old workflow for now and flag any deal friction to finance. Here's the part to keep close.

internal memo for kahop-yajof: The steering committee signed off on a budget of $12.6 million for Project Jorwyn. The renewal with Quenoxox Logistics closes at $16.8 million a year, 48 percent above the last contract.

## Guest Wi-Fi Desk — Reception, Aldercote Works

Visiting contractors: guest Wi-Fi credentials are issued only at the reception desk, ground floor. Sign in first. Credentials expire daily at 18:00; renew each morning. No personal hotspots inside the workshop areas. Hardwired connections require a separate request via your site contact. The Wi-Fi desk sits behind the secure reception barrier, so you'll need to be buzzed through or let yourself in. The barrier door code is below.

turnstile pass: bdg-YPPQB-52010

MEMO — Kettling Depot Receiving

Uniform sets for the new Kettling depot arrive Wednesday via Ashgrove courier: 40 boxes, sorted by size, manifest attached to box one. Check the count at the dock before signing; shortages go straight to stores, not the courier. The hand-over instruction the courier will follow is set out below.

drop instructions, tafof-baguf: the holmir gilox courier leaves the sormir ulaok holdor ledger at gate 5596 under passcode 257343